Technical notes
pH Calculator computes pH = −log₁₀[H⁺] (and pOH = 14 − pH) from the hydrogen-ion concentration.
Results assume ideal conditions and consistent units, so convert your inputs to the units shown before calculating.
All arithmetic runs in your browser using double-precision floating point, so extreme inputs may show tiny rounding differences.

Can I enter pH instead of concentration?
Yes. You can start from H⁺ or OH⁻ concentration, or from a pH or pOH value, and the rest are calculated.
How are pH and pOH related?
At 25°C they add up to 14, so pOH = 14 − pH.
Why must concentration be positive?
pH uses the logarithm of concentration, which is only defined for values greater than zero.

Worked example
A solution with [H⁺] = 1 × 10⁻³ M has pH = −log₁₀(10⁻³) = 3 (acidic).
